- 浏览: 131574 次
- 性别:
- 来自: 北京
文章分类
- 全部博客 (140)
- ruby on rails (23)
- 随笔 (1)
- 部署 (3)
- ubuntu源 (2)
- linux (28)
- web (9)
- IT (3)
- linux,数据库 (3)
- MOOC (4)
- ubuntu (20)
- win7 (2)
- git (6)
- github (2)
- ubuntu,python (1)
- java,JDK (1)
- ubuntu,qq (1)
- vagrant (3)
- virtualbox (2)
- sass (1)
- centos (3)
- Sublime (1)
- nginx (4)
- passenger (1)
- VPN (0)
- mysql (4)
- VIM (1)
- bbb (1)
- 编码设置 (2)
- mongo (4)
- edx (2)
- ssh (1)
- python (1)
- phpmyadmin (1)
- libreoffice (2)
- docker (4)
- pg (1)
- PostgreSQL (2)
- 系统时间设置 (1)
- ansible (1)
- Sinatra (1)
- 硬盘挂载 (1)
- npm (1)
- smtp (1)
- docker 镜像 (1)
- Memcached (1)
最新评论
http://www.cnblogs.com/lynch_world/archive/2012/01/06/2314717.html
http://hi.baidu.com/evin_chen/item/67b6bbe66ae036d8e3a5d48b
1、安装Apache服务
sudo apt-get install apache2
运行如下命令重启下: sudo /etc/init.d/apache2 restart
2、安装php5
安装 PHP5 和 Apache PHP5 模块
sudo apt-get install php5
sudo apt-get install libapache2-mod-php5
重启下Apache
sudo /etc/init.d/apache2 restart
测试,查看一下是否生效了。
sudo gedit /var/www/phpinfo.php
<?php
echo phpinfo();
?>
保存运行http://127.0.0.1/phpinfo.php
3、安装Mysql
sudo apt-get install mysql-server mysql-client
4、让apache、php支持mysql
sudo apt-get install libapache2-mod-auth-mysql
sudo apt-get install php5-mysql
sudo /etc/init.d/apache2 restart
至此apache+php+mysql的环境就完成了。
然后安装所需模块,例如下面的命令:
sudo apt-get install php5-mysql php5-curl php5-gd php5-intl php-pear php5-imagick php5-imap php5-mcrypt php5-memcache php5-ming php5-ps php5-pspell php5-recode php5-snmp php5-sqlite php5-tidy php5-xmlrpc php5-xsl
重启 Apache2:
/etc/init.d/apache2 restart
然后打开 http://127.0.01/phpinfo.php 查看模块支持是不是已经增加了。
5、安装phpmyadmin
安装phpmyadmin来管理mysql:
sudo apt-get install phpmyadmin
配置phpmyadmin
phpmyadmin 默认并不是安装在 /var/www下面的而是在 /usr/share/phpmyadmin
你可以创建一个链接 然后把链接复制过去:
sudo ln -s /usr/share/phpmyadmin /var/www
然后 终端中运行命令
sudo gedit /etc/phpmyadmin/apache.conf
然后把下面一句:
Alias /phpmyadmin /usr/share/phpmyadmin
改为:
Alias /phpmyadmin /var/www/phpmyadmin
二.附录
1> apache 的配置文件路径 /etc/apache2/apache2.conf
2> php.ini 路径 /etc/php5/apache2/php5.ini
3> mysql配置文件 路径 /etc/mysql/my.cnf
4> phpmyadmin配置文件路径 /etc/phpmyadmin/apache.conf
5> 网站根目录 /var/www
1.配置apache
终端中 使用命令
sudo gedit /etc/apache2/apache2.conf
在配置文件最后面加入下面几行:
添加文件类型支持
AddType application/x-httpd-php .php .htm .html
默认字符集 根据自己需要
AddDefaultCharset UTF-8
服务器地址
ServerName 127.0.0.1
添加首页文件 三个的顺序可以换 前面的访问优先 (当然你也可以加别的 比如default.php)
DirectoryIndex index.htm index.html index.php
2.配置PHP5
这个没什么好说的 根据个人自己需要
下面是默认时区
;default.timezone=去掉前面的分号 后面加个PRC 。表示中华人民共和国(就是GMT+8时区)
default.timezone= PRC
3.配置mysql
sudo gedit /etc/mysql/my.cnf
这里有一个地方要注意
因为默认是只允许本地访问数据库的 如果你有需要 可以打开。
bind-address 127.0.0.1这一句是限制只能本地访问mysql的。如果有需要其他机器访问 把这句话用#注释掉
#bind-address 127.0.0.1
常用命令
1.重启apache
sudo /etc/init.d/apache2 restart
2.重启mysql
sudo /etc/init.d/mysql restart
GD库的安装
sudo apt-get install php5-gd
记得装完重启apache
sudo /etc/init.d/apache2 restart
启用 mod_rewrite 模块
sudo a2enmod rewrite
ruby on rails mysql
An error occurred while installing mysql2 (0.3.13), and Bundler cannot continue.
Make sure that `gem install mysql2 -v '0.3.13'` succeeds before bundling.
sudo apt-get install libmysql-ruby libmysqlclient-dev
http://hi.baidu.com/evin_chen/item/67b6bbe66ae036d8e3a5d48b
1、安装Apache服务
sudo apt-get install apache2
运行如下命令重启下: sudo /etc/init.d/apache2 restart
2、安装php5
安装 PHP5 和 Apache PHP5 模块
sudo apt-get install php5
sudo apt-get install libapache2-mod-php5
重启下Apache
sudo /etc/init.d/apache2 restart
测试,查看一下是否生效了。
sudo gedit /var/www/phpinfo.php
<?php
echo phpinfo();
?>
保存运行http://127.0.0.1/phpinfo.php
3、安装Mysql
sudo apt-get install mysql-server mysql-client
4、让apache、php支持mysql
sudo apt-get install libapache2-mod-auth-mysql
sudo apt-get install php5-mysql
sudo /etc/init.d/apache2 restart
至此apache+php+mysql的环境就完成了。
然后安装所需模块,例如下面的命令:
sudo apt-get install php5-mysql php5-curl php5-gd php5-intl php-pear php5-imagick php5-imap php5-mcrypt php5-memcache php5-ming php5-ps php5-pspell php5-recode php5-snmp php5-sqlite php5-tidy php5-xmlrpc php5-xsl
重启 Apache2:
/etc/init.d/apache2 restart
然后打开 http://127.0.01/phpinfo.php 查看模块支持是不是已经增加了。
5、安装phpmyadmin
安装phpmyadmin来管理mysql:
sudo apt-get install phpmyadmin
配置phpmyadmin
phpmyadmin 默认并不是安装在 /var/www下面的而是在 /usr/share/phpmyadmin
你可以创建一个链接 然后把链接复制过去:
sudo ln -s /usr/share/phpmyadmin /var/www
然后 终端中运行命令
sudo gedit /etc/phpmyadmin/apache.conf
然后把下面一句:
Alias /phpmyadmin /usr/share/phpmyadmin
改为:
Alias /phpmyadmin /var/www/phpmyadmin
二.附录
1> apache 的配置文件路径 /etc/apache2/apache2.conf
2> php.ini 路径 /etc/php5/apache2/php5.ini
3> mysql配置文件 路径 /etc/mysql/my.cnf
4> phpmyadmin配置文件路径 /etc/phpmyadmin/apache.conf
5> 网站根目录 /var/www
1.配置apache
终端中 使用命令
sudo gedit /etc/apache2/apache2.conf
在配置文件最后面加入下面几行:
添加文件类型支持
AddType application/x-httpd-php .php .htm .html
默认字符集 根据自己需要
AddDefaultCharset UTF-8
服务器地址
ServerName 127.0.0.1
添加首页文件 三个的顺序可以换 前面的访问优先 (当然你也可以加别的 比如default.php)
DirectoryIndex index.htm index.html index.php
2.配置PHP5
这个没什么好说的 根据个人自己需要
下面是默认时区
;default.timezone=去掉前面的分号 后面加个PRC 。表示中华人民共和国(就是GMT+8时区)
default.timezone= PRC
3.配置mysql
sudo gedit /etc/mysql/my.cnf
这里有一个地方要注意
因为默认是只允许本地访问数据库的 如果你有需要 可以打开。
bind-address 127.0.0.1这一句是限制只能本地访问mysql的。如果有需要其他机器访问 把这句话用#注释掉
#bind-address 127.0.0.1
常用命令
1.重启apache
sudo /etc/init.d/apache2 restart
2.重启mysql
sudo /etc/init.d/mysql restart
GD库的安装
sudo apt-get install php5-gd
记得装完重启apache
sudo /etc/init.d/apache2 restart
启用 mod_rewrite 模块
sudo a2enmod rewrite
ruby on rails mysql
An error occurred while installing mysql2 (0.3.13), and Bundler cannot continue.
Make sure that `gem install mysql2 -v '0.3.13'` succeeds before bundling.
sudo apt-get install libmysql-ruby libmysqlclient-dev
发表评论
-
Ubuntu apt-get彻底卸载软件包
2017-02-23 12:19 650apt-get purge / apt-get –purge ... -
dpkg
2015-11-05 13:26 0dpkg -l|grep virtualbox sudo d ... -
ubuntu 播放器 播放不了的解决方式
2015-03-27 13:49 597ubuntu 播放器 播放不了的解决方式: sudo apt ... -
ubuntu server 12.04 配置静态ip
2015-02-11 16:56 5551、配置静态IP地址: # vim /etc/network ... -
ubuntu 查看操作系统信息
2014-12-10 17:34 613方法一: cat /etc/issue 返回结果: ... -
ssh 配置不用手动输入用户密码直接登录
2014-11-26 11:38 718需要3个东西 1. 安装expect 2. autossh 3 ... -
ubuntu增加swap交换空间的步骤
2014-10-30 16:27 5731.首先用命令free查看系统内 Swap 分区大小。 fre ... -
ubuntu 终端文本浏览器w3m或者lynx
2014-09-03 11:32 2780sudo apt-get install lynx-cur ... -
Ubuntu下apt-get命令详解
2014-07-02 13:21 529在Ubuntu下,apt-get近乎是最常用的shell命令之 ... -
无挂断程序操作
2014-06-06 17:03 572启动 $ rails s 这个界面一直占用,关掉会退出服 ... -
vi 编辑强制保存
2014-05-26 16:30 1209有时VIM编辑时候没有以sudo 开始,等到保存时候发现蛋疼了 ... -
ubuntu 编码设置UTF8
2014-05-13 10:34 2944sudo locale-gen en_US.UTF-8 su ... -
ubuntu vim 编程好帮手
2014-05-09 16:33 490ubuntu vim 编程好帮手 sudo apt-get i ... -
ubuntu上部署etherpad(生产环境)
2014-05-07 18:31 938Nginx: To put EL behind revers ... -
如何把主机的文件复制到virtualbox(ubuntu)里
2014-03-13 00:11 2505http://www.cnblogs.com/hqucth/a ... -
SASS用法指南
2014-03-07 12:15 389http://www.w3cplus.com/sassguid ... -
Python模板库Mako的语法(译自官方文档)
2014-03-03 16:10 729http://www.yeolar.com/note/2012 ... -
谷歌浏览器翻×墙(linux)
2014-02-14 14:54 2下载所需要的东西: 1.https://developers. ... -
ubuntu 安装火狐flash失败占用dpkg解决
2014-01-23 16:27 838$ sudo rm -rf /var/lib/dpkg/loc ... -
Ubuntu下nfs安装
2013-12-24 11:39 1091Ubuntu 默认是没有nfs服务的,所以需要自己安装 1、 ...
相关推荐
Ubuntu下LAMP(linux+apache+mysql+php)环境的配置与安装.pdf
ubuntu下Apache+PHP+MySQL安装配置所需的资源及一份教程 由于上传大小限制,共分三个文件 一共包括: mysql-5.0.67-linux-i686-icc-glibc23.tar.gz httpd-2.2.11.tar.gz jpegsrc.v6b.tar.gz zlib-1.2.3.tar.gz ...
主要是在linux上安装mysql+apache+php+wordpress,linux,suselinux,ubuntu都可以,笔记很详细,对于新手非常有帮助
ubuntu+apache2+php5+mysql5.0的安装
在ubuntu下搭建Apache+MySQL+PHP开发环境[参考].pdf
这个教程是帮助人们在 Ubuntu 上搭建一个 LAMP(Linux+Apache+MySQL+PHP)服务器,使用 如下软件:apache2,PHP5(在 ubuntu6.10 或更低版本使用 PHP4),MySQL4.1 或者 5.0。 在这里我针对 ubuntu7.04 及以后版本适用的...
详细的讲解了Ubuntu 16.04 LTS下安装Apache2+PHP7.0+MySQL+phpMyAdmin图文详解
Ubuntu下LAMP(linux+apache+mysql+php)环境的配置与安装参考.pdf
Ubuntu16.04下的Apache+PHP+Mysql环境搭建 (1)安装搭建Apache2 (2)安装MySQL (3)安装PHP、PHPmyadmin (4)配置PHPmyadmin
主要介绍了Ubuntu下Apache+PHP+MySQL环境搭建攻略,文中采用的是LoadModule加载模块的方式将PHP与Apache服务器程序连接,需要的朋友可以参考下
PHP环境配置在Ubuntu下是非常轻松的,这里采用的是Ubuntu软件库中的Apache、MySQL、PHP进行安装操作
所以笔者此次尝试了在Ubuntu 11.10平台下的本地服务器配置(配置Apache+PHP+MySQL)。 废话少说,步入整体。 流程笔记: 1.打开终端,输入“sudo apt-get install apache2”,回车;(安装apache2.0) ...
Ubuntu下快速搭建Apache2+MySQL+PHP5开发环境[归纳].pdf
Ubuntu Server 菜鸟配置手册+Ubuntu 官方文档中文翻译版 适合初学者架设服务器
为CentOS / Debian / Ubuntu安装LAMP(Linux + Apache + MySQL / MariaDB / Percona Server + PHP)描述LAMP是一个功能强大的bash脚本,用于安装Apache + PHP + MySQL / MariaDB / Percona Server等。 您可以通过...
二、安装PHP,Apache 和 MySQL 三、配置Apache 四、MySQL + PHP 搭建简单的登陆页面 五、效果展示 一、在虚拟机中安装ubunutu 这里使用Ubuntu 18.04.4 LTS, 下载链接。 打开vmware,点击创建新的虚拟机,选择下载好...
ubuntu lamp(apache+mysql+php) 环境搭建及相关扩展更新,需要的朋友可以参考下。
Win7 x64系统下PHP开发环境搭建,包含详细操作步骤及所需安装包百度盘下载 (Apache2.4.18+PHP5.6.16+MySQL5.7.10+phpMyAdmin4.5.3.1)